(AURORA, Ore. ) - At about 9:30 AM this morning deputies recieved a call from Loy Russell, owner of Russell's Nursery Inc, who reported that someone had taken 600 plants from one of the greenhouses at his nursery located at 22241 Boones Ferry Rd NE, Aurora.
The plants were assorted varieties of grafted Japanese Maple trees ranging in size from about 16" to as tall as 28". The trees had either green or purple leaves.
Mr. Russell said that the grafted area on each tree was wrapped in Scotch type tape which he says is not the usual industry method of securing grafts.
The estimated value of the stolen trees is about $5000.
Anyone with information about the stolen trees or the person or people that may have stolen them is asked to call the Marion County Sheriff's Office at (503) 588-5032.
